you should NOT be picking the firm based on hourly pay...

but yes CS LA does pay hourly from what i hear

any of those would be phenominal for PE, if you want to do MBA or Corp Dev i would stay stick to the cookie cutter BB name. GS then MS then CS

but PE would prob be Moelis then CS then MS then GS LA. nice problem your friend seems to be having haha
